Transaction 51c3673f0c4cf865910235ffccb41fe44d135fad07b994b70d09852a92cf2d46

block
19b574f83eb86792170a14b5c3c5c767ef1f4ca21c7685687e9c7255b5782262

1 Input

24 Outputs